I made a ton and put it in a container for later use.
Ingredients: - 3 1/2 cups sugar - 2 1/4 cups cocoa powder - a sprinkle of salt (optional, I chose not to) Directions: 1. Simply whisk all together, then transfer to a container for later use. 2. To prepare a single cup of cocoa, microwave the milk in your mug, then add 1-2 tablespoons hot chocolate powder, stirring until combined. Decorate with marshmallows, whipped cream, even crushed candy cane or peppermint. Credits to Martha Stewart! : https://www.marthastewart.com/353001/homemade-hot-chocolate -Charlotte
